Introduction to ColdCard MK4

The ColdCard MK4 is a highly secure Bitcoin hardware wallet designed for deep cold storage and air-gapped transactions. This tutorial will guide you through setting up your ColdCard MK4 from scratch, including sending/receiving Bitcoin and integrating it with Sparrow Wallet for a fully offline experience.

Sending & Receiving Bitcoin

Receiving Bitcoin

  1. In Sparrow Wallet, generate a receiving address.
  2. Verify the address on your ColdCard’s screen.

Sending Bitcoin

  1. Create a PSBT in Sparrow Wallet.
  2. Transfer it via MicroSD to ColdCard for signing.
  3. Broadcast the signed transaction using Sparrow.

FAQ Section

Q1: Is ColdCard MK4 compatible with mobile devices?

A: Yes—via NFC (though air-gapping is recommended for security).

Q2: Can I recover my wallet if I lose my ColdCard?

A: Absolutely! Use your seed phrase with any BIP39-compatible wallet.

Q3: Why use Sparrow Wallet instead of Electrum?

A: Sparrow offers better privacy (CoinJoin support) and a cleaner UI for PSBT workflows.
